Design and Build Quality

The Export series is known for its solid build, and the EXX725BR/C is no exception.

  • Shell Construction: The shells are crafted using 6-ply, 7.5mm Poplar and Asian Mahogany through Pearl’s Superior Shell Technology (SST). This construction provides a balanced tonal blend of warmth and attack, suitable for a variety of genres.
  • Finish Options: Pearl offers several eye-catching lacquer and wrap finishes, including Jet Black, Pure White, and Smokey Chrome, allowing drummers to choose a kit that matches their style.
  • Durability: The shells and hardware are built to withstand heavy use, making this kit an excellent long-term investment for students or gigging drummers.

Configuration

The EXX725BR/C is a 5-piece kit featuring a standard configuration that suits most playing styles:

  • Bass Drum: 22″x18″ — Powerful and punchy, perfect for rock, pop, and funk.
  • Toms: 12″x8″ and 13″x9″ — Balanced and versatile, providing a great tonal range.
  • Floor Tom: 16″x16″ — Deep, resonant, and perfect for heavy grooves.
  • Snare Drum: 14″x5.5″ — Crisp, responsive, and adaptable to various tunings.

The kit includes a complete set of hardware and cymbals, making it ideal for beginners who need an all-in-one package.


Hardware

Pearl’s Export kits have always been known for their reliable hardware, and the EXX725BR/C takes it a step further.

  • Hardware Pack: The included HWP-830 hardware pack features double-braced stands that ensure stability and durability. The pack includes a snare stand, hi-hat stand, straight cymbal stand, boom cymbal stand, and a robust drum throne.
  • Pedal: The P-930 Demonator bass drum pedal is a standout feature, offering smooth action and adjustability for drummers seeking better foot control.
  • Mounting System: The Opti-Loc Mounting System provides wobble-free stability for the toms while allowing maximum shell resonance, enhancing the kit’s tonal projection.

Cymbals

The kit comes with Sabian SBR cymbals, which include:

  • Hi-Hats: 14″ — Bright and crisp, suitable for most genres.
  • Crash: 16″ — Versatile but somewhat thin-sounding for heavy playing.
  • Ride: 20″ — Decent articulation, though it may lack the complexity of higher-end models.

While the included cymbals are adequate for beginners, more advanced players may consider upgrading to professional-grade cymbals over time.


Sound Quality

The Pearl EXX725BR/C offers impressive sound quality for its price point.

  • Bass Drum: The 22″x18″ bass drum delivers a deep, punchy tone with plenty of low-end resonance. Adding a pillow or damping can help fine-tune the tone for specific genres.
  • Toms: The toms offer a balanced and focused tone, with enough warmth from the mahogany to complement the attack from the poplar. They perform well across tuning ranges.
  • Snare Drum: The snare is responsive and versatile, delivering sharp attacks at higher tunings and a fat, warm tone at lower tunings.
  • Projection: Thanks to the SST shell construction, the kit has excellent projection, making it suitable for practice, gigs, and recording.
